Refresher: The Last of Us Season 1 in a Nutshell

For those who have watched The Last of Us (2023-) and need a refresher on the characters and events of season 1.

Major Characters 

Joel (Pedro Pascal)

Joel Miller

Joel (Pedro Pascal) was a contractor and single father before the apocalypse. During the initial outbreak, he fled with his brother, Tommy, and daughter, Sarah, but she gets killed on their way out of town. Over the next 20 years, it’s implied that Joel did some terrible things to survive, which caused him and Tommy to part ways. He established himself in the Boston QZ with his girlfriend, Tess. Joel and Tess get tasked to escort Ellie, an immune teenager, to a lab where a cure might be developed from Ellie’s immunity. Tess dies early on, so most of the journey is with Joel and Ellie on their own. Although Joel is initially resistant to letting himself care about Ellie, he gradually grows close to her. During their journey, he reconciles with Tommy, who now has a wife and a community in Wyoming.

By the time Joel and Ellie finish their journey, she’s become like a new daughter to him. He’s finally found a reason to live again, and can’t bear the thought of losing her. However, when the time comes to hand her over to the Fireflies developing the cure, he learns that they will need to kill her in order to get the samples needed to produce the cure. Joel cannot let this happen, so he chooses Ellie, even though he knows that doing so will essentially doom the world to the infection with no hope for reprieve. He kills the Fireflies involved, including the doctor who was going to perform the surgery on Ellie, and takes Ellie away with him to build a new life in Tommy’s community. He lies to Ellie about what happened, claiming that she was no longer needed and that a cure is impossible.

Ellie (Bella Ramsey)

Ellie Williams

Ellie (Bella Ramsey) is an orphan who was raised at a FEDRA military school, where she became best friends with and developed a crush on Riley. As teenagers, Riley joins the Fireflies, a militia rebel group, and tries to convince Ellie to come with her. The two are attacked by the infected, and each is bitten, but though Riley turns, Ellie ends up being immune due to her mother having been bitten while in the middle of giving birth to her. Ellie is sent by Firefly Marleen to a Firefly lab, where they hope to develop a cure with the aid of Ellie’s immunity. When Marleen is injured and unable to get her there personally, Ellie is instead sent with Joel and his girlfriend, Tess. Tess dies early on, and along the journey with Joel to reach the Fireflies, several other characters are encountered and also die, including a boy named Sam who Ellie had grown fond of. Because of all of this, Ellie becomes very attached to Joel, having lost everyone else she’s ever known or cared about, which breaks through his rough exterior.

Prior to the start of her journey, Ellie lived her life in relative safety with FEDRA, and now, for the first time, she must go to greater lengths to survive than she has before, relying on Joel’s help. At one point, Joel is injured and Ellie must nurse him back to health and survive on her own for a while. During this time, she encounters David, the leader of a community that has resorted to cannibalism to survive. David develops an obsession with Ellie and tries to force her to join him, which leads to Ellie having to kill him.

The cure becomes really important to Ellie, something to give her a sense of purpose and something that will provide meaning to all the deaths of those they lost along the way. They reach the Fireflies, and Ellie is sedated and prepped for surgery. Unbeknownst to her, Joel is told that the only way to develop the cure is to sacrifice Ellie in order to dissect her to get what they need. Joel refuses to allow this, killing the Fireflies and fleeing with Ellie without giving her a chance to decide for herself if this is something she’d be willing to do. When Ellie wakes up, Joel falsely claims that the Fireflies determined that the cure was impossible and that they no longer needed her. She wants to believe him, but a part of her suspects that this isn’t true.

Tommy (Gabriel Luna)

Tommy Miller

Tommy (Gabriel Luna) is Joel’s brother. The two were once close, but over the years following the apocalypse, Joel dragged Tommy into some situations that pushed Tommy away. Eventually, Tommy left Joel and joined the Fireflies, though over time Tommy left them as well. By the time Joel and Ellie meet up with Tommy, he is now married to a woman named Maria, who is pregnant, and they’ve established a life in a pleasant community in Wyoming. Joel and Tommy make amends, and Joel meant to leave Ellie with Tommy at this point, but ultimately Joel stays with Ellie to continue on towards their goal, so they leave Tommy in Wyoming with Maria. At the end of the season, Joel and Ellie head back to Wyoming to join Tommy and Maria in their community.

Key Takeaways

Main Story

  • Joel Miller (Pedro Pascal) and his brother Tommy (Gabriel Luna) are survivors of a zombie-like apocalypse in which a fungus infects and takes over humans
    • During the initial outbreak, Joel’s daughter, Sarah (Nico Parker) dies, and Joel still grieves her loss
  • 20 years after the outbreak, a government agency called FEDRA has established quarantine zones (QZs) to house the survivors
    • Survivors aren’t allowed to leave the QZs due to the danger from both infected and bandits
    • A militia group called the Fireflies rose up over time to oppose FEDRA’s strict constraints, but the Fireflies have gradually fallen apart
  • Joel and his girlfriend, Tess (Anna Torv), get unexpectedly tasked by a Firefly named Marleen (Merle Dandridge) to escort a teenager named Ellie (Bella Ramsey) to a larger Firefly group
    • Although Joel and Tess aren’t, themselves, Fireflies, Tommy spent some time with them so there’s a begrudging trust
  • When Joel and Tess realize that Ellie is immune to the infection, having been bit three weeks ago and still not turned, they end up deciding to take Ellie much further than originally agreed
    • The Fireflies have a lab in Colorado that may be able to develop a cure
    • Since Tommy used to be a Firefly, they intend to take Ellie to him in Wyoming, then send her the rest of the way with him
    • On their way out of their home QZ in Boston, Tess sacrifices herself to help Joel and Ellie get away, but Tess first stresses the importance for Joel to see this through
  • As they journey to Wyoming, Joel and Ellie struggle to get along at first, largely due to Joel’s hesitance to grow close to anyone after losing Sarah, but over time they develop a father/daughter type relationship anyway
  • When they reach Tommy’s community in Wyoming, led by Tommy’s wife Maria (Rutina Wesley), Joel expects to leave Ellie at this point, but Ellie convinces him to go the rest of the way with her
  • Joel and Ellie make it to the Firefly lab in Colorado, but the Firefly group has relocated
    • Joel and Ellie continue on to Salt Lake City to find them
  • By the time they finally reach their goal, Joel has grown very fond of Ellie, only to learn that they cannot develop the cure without killing Ellie in the process
    • Unable to let her die, Joel kills the Fireflies there – including Marleen and the doctor (Darren Dolynski) who was going to perform the surgery on Ellie – and takes Ellie back to Wyoming
    • Ellie is unconscious during this, and when she wakes up, Joel lies to her about what happened, claiming that the lab had determined there was no way to develop a cure, so Ellie was not needed after all

Side Stories

At various points in their journey, Joel and Ellie encounter some other characters

Bill (Nick Offerman) and Frank (Murray Bartlett)

  • Bill (Nick Offerman) and Frank (Murray Bartlett) are a gay couple who have been friends with Joel and Tess for a long time
    • Joel and Ellie stop by their place to get supplies, but by the time they arrive, the couple has committed mutual suicide due to Frank’s failing health
Sam (Keivonn Woodard) and Henry (Lamar Johnson)

  • Henry (Lamar Johnson) and Sam (Keivonn Woodard) are brothers stuck in a hostile community led by Kathleen (Melanie Lynskey)
    • When Joel and Ellie get ambushed passing through the community, they cross paths with the brothers
    • The two pairs join forces and help each other get out of the community
    • Ellie and Sam, being close in age, form a bond
    • Sam is bitten by an infected, and despite Ellie’s efforts to save him, he still turns
    • Henry puts Sam down, but can’t bear the grief and shoots himself
David (Scott Shepherd)

  • David (Scott Shepherd) leads his own community that has resorted to cannibalism
    • David’s men wound Joel, and Ellie must take care of him
    • David becomes obsessed with Ellie and tries to force her to join him, which leads to her having to kill him to get away
Ellie (Bella Ramsey) and Riley (Storm Reid)

  • In a flashback, we see Ellie’s backstory
    • Ellie’s mom, Anna (Ashley Johnson), was a friend of Marleen’s who got bitten while in labor, leading to Ellie’s immunity
    • Marleen took baby Ellie to a FEDRA camp for orphans where she grew up with Riley (Storm Reid)
    • Not long before the start of the show, Riley defected and joined the Fireflies, but came back to try to convince Ellie to join her
    • The pair, who are best friends with unspoken romantic undertones, spend an evening having a last hoorah in an abandoned mall, where they are attacked by infected
    • Both Riley and Ellie are bitten, and though Riley turns, Ellie does not and is rescued by Marleen, which leads to the start of the show
